With more sophisticated electronics powering our daily lives, manufacturers that want to automate their assembly operations have to incorporate resistance and HiPot testing into the machine cell. These tests are essential for ensuring product quality but remain a time-consuming process when performed manually.
Most of today’s manufacturers strive for zero out-of-box failures. An acceptable part per million (ppm) failure rate in high-reliability environments at large manufacturers usually has a process capability index (Cpk) of 1.67. That is less than one part per million that fails.
Because circuits are critical to process capability analysis, automating resistance and HiPot testing improves manufacturing reliability, reduces cycle times, and enables a repeatable, compliant, and profitable operation.

Intec Automation develops automated electronic manufacturing machine cells that include HiPot and resistance testing stations. Our solution incorporates inline vision systems with automated material handling and product manipulation devices that eliminate the need for operators to perform these validations.
Once the DUT reaches the station, a vision-guided system will locate and register the fiducials on the board to match the contact points with the test unit. A multi-axis gantry keeps the circuit or panel in place before starting the test operation. From here, we can execute the HiPot and resistance tests according to your design and validation requirements. The system will record the outcome of each test, and if necessary, feed any data to the Manufacturing Execution System (MES) for record-keeping purposes.
With this solution, manufacturers can provide demonstrable compliance results for each circuit and automatically reject any that failed, even when they make up part of a circuit array or panel during the breakout process.
The machine cell’s tooling is modular and customizable to accommodate any type of board design. Quick changeovers are built into the solution, allowing manufacturers to switch between different products with limited downtime.
